Visiting Someone at Deschutes County Adult Jail
If your loved one is being held at Deschutes County Adult Jail, you can visit them during scheduled visitation hours. Most facilities in Deschutes County require visitors to have a valid government-issued photo ID and to follow a dress code. Minors are typically allowed with a legal guardian.
Visitation schedules change frequently, so call Deschutes County Adult Jail directly at (541) 388-6655 to confirm current visiting hours before making the trip. Many Deschutes County facilities now offer video visitation as an alternative — ask about availability when you call.
Keep in mind that visitation privileges can be revoked if facility rules are not followed. Arrive early, leave prohibited items in your vehicle, and be patient with security screening.
The Booking Process at Deschutes County Adult Jail
When someone is arrested and brought to Deschutes County Adult Jail (also referred to as the Deschutes County detention center), they go through a booking and intake process that typically takes anywhere from 2 to 6 hours depending on how busy the facility is. During intake, the individual is fingerprinted, photographed, and their personal information is entered into the system.
Personal belongings are inventoried and stored until release. A background check is run, and if there are any outstanding warrants, those will be addressed as well. Once booking is complete, a bail amount is set based on the charges and the Deschutes County bail schedule — or a judge may set bail at an arraignment hearing.
During this time, the arrested person can usually make phone calls. If you're waiting to hear from someone who was just arrested, be patient — the process takes time. How Bail Works at Deschutes County Adult Jail
Once bail has been set for an inmate at Deschutes County Adult Jail, you have several options to bond out your loved one and secure their release from the detention facility. The most common method is working with a licensed bail bondsman, who will post the full bail amount on your behalf in exchange for a non-refundable premium — typically 10% of the total bail in Oregon.

How to Bail Someone Out of Deschutes County Adult Jail
📋 What You Need
- • Defendant's full legal name
- • Booking number (call jail at (541) 388-6655)
- • Bail amount
- • Your valid photo ID
- • Payment for the bond premium (usually 10%)
⏱️ How Long Does It Take?
- • Contacting a bondsman: 5 minutes
- • Paperwork: 20-30 minutes
- • Jail processing release: 2-12 hours
- • Total: Same day in most cases
Step-by-Step Process:
- Call the jail at (541) 388-6655 to confirm the person is in custody and get the bail amount
- Call a bail bondsman who serves Deschutes County Adult Jail (see listings above)
- Pay the premium — typically 10% of bail. Most bondsmen accept cash, credit cards, and offer payment plans
- Sign paperwork — the bondsman will handle the rest with the court
- Release — once the bond is posted, the jail will process the release (timing varies)
